Sdílet prostřednictvím


Out-Null

Skryje výstup místo odeslání kanálu nebo jeho zobrazení.

Syntaxe

Out-Null
   [-InputObject <PSObject>]
   [<CommonParameters>]

Description

Rutina Out-Null odešle výstup na hodnotu NULL, čímž se odebere z kanálu a zabrání zobrazení výstupu na obrazovce. To má vliv jenom na standardní výstupní datový proud. Jiné výstupní datové proudy, jako je chybový proud, nejsou ovlivněny. Zobrazí se výjimky. To usnadňuje testování příkazu pro případné chyby.

Příklady

Příklad 1: Odstranění výstupu

Get-ChildItem | Out-Null

Tento příkaz získá položky v aktuálním umístění nebo adresáři, ale jeho výstup se nepředá kanálem ani se nezobrazí na příkazovém řádku. To je užitečné pro skrytí výstupu, který nepotřebujete.

Parametry

-InputObject

Určuje objekt, který se má odeslat do hodnoty NULL (odebrán z kanálu). Zadejte proměnnou, která obsahuje objekty, nebo zadejte příkaz nebo výraz, který objekty získá.

Typ:PSObject
Position:Named
Default value:None
Vyžadováno:False
Přijmout vstup kanálu:True
Přijmout zástupné znaky:False

Vstupy

PSObject

Do této rutiny můžete převést libovolný objekt.

Výstupy

None

Tato rutina nevrátí žádný výstup.

Poznámky

  • Rutiny, které obsahují příkaz Out (rutiny Out), nemají parametry pro názvy nebo cesty k souborům. Pokud chcete odesílat data do rutiny Out, použijte operátor kanálu (|) k odeslání výstupu příkazu Windows PowerShellu do rutiny. Data můžete také uložit do proměnné a pomocí parametru InputObject předat data rutině. Další informace najdete v příkladech.
  • Out-Null nevrací žádné výstupní objekty. Pokud předáte výstup Out-Null do rutiny Get-Member, Get-Member hlásí, že nebyly zadány žádné objekty.